Abstract(in English) The linearly tapered slot antenna (LTSA) is known as a wide bandwidth antenna. In this paper, LTSAs fed by CPW feeding line were fabricated and tested at the X-band. The experimental results of these antennas confirmed high performance in both radiation patterns and return loss characteristics. Moreover, some results on the electric fields which are computed by FD-TD method are also presented here. As a result of these experiments, it is shown that LTSA fed by CPW is effective as a new type of wide bandwidth planar antenna.
